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 788127 - dev-java/piccolo2d-3.0-r2 stabilisation (was: 3.0-r1 depends on dev-java/swt:3.8 and is EAPI-5 based)
Summary: dev-java/piccolo2d-3.0-r2 stabilisation (was: 3.0-r1 depends on dev-java/swt:...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Stabilization (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Java team
URL:
Whiteboard:
Keywords: CC-ARCHES, PullRequest, STABLEREQ
Depends on: 790761 796320
Blocks: EAPI5Removal 786870
  Show dependency tree
 
Reported: 2021-05-04 10:01 UTC by Andreas Sturmlechner
Modified: 2021-11-19 09:11 UTC (History)
2 users (show)

See Also:
Package list:
dev-java/piccolo2d-3.0-r2 x86
Runtime testing required: ---
nattka: sanity-check-


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Andreas Sturmlechner gentoo-dev 2021-05-04 10:01:06 UTC
One of two packages blocking cleanup of dev-java/swt:3.8.

Upstream repository talks about a 3.0.1 tag:

https://github.com/piccolo2d/piccolo2d.java/commit/065dbab423cc83c1ce9360723504367fec306e74
Comment 1 Miroslav Šulc gentoo-dev 2021-06-23 08:30:46 UTC
commit 783c8485a037daa4ae77bae452e57067c51da5d7
Author: Volkmar W. Pogatzki <gentoo@pogatzki.net>
Date:   Tue May 18 13:47:20 2021 +0200

    dev-java/piccolo2d: swt:4.10 slot update, min java 1.8
    
    Package-Manager: Portage-3.0.18, Repoman-3.0.2
    Signed-off-by: Volkmar W. Pogatzki <gentoo@pogatzki.net>
    Closes: https://github.com/gentoo/gentoo/pull/20865/commits/a7a4809d27625bbddda43f0c81af865942e9d3b0
    Signed-off-by: Miroslav Šulc <fordfrog@gentoo.org>
Comment 2 Agostino Sarubbo gentoo-dev 2021-06-25 06:19:08 UTC
amd64 stable
Comment 3 ernsteiswuerfel archtester 2021-07-18 22:57:04 UTC
Looking good on ppc64.

 # cat piccolo2d-788127.report 
USE tests started on Mo 19. Jul 00:40:35 CEST 2021

FEATURES=' test' USE='' succeeded for =dev-java/piccolo2d-3.0-r2
USE='-doc -examples -source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='doc -examples -source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='-doc examples -source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='doc examples -source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='-doc -examples source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='doc -examples source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='-doc examples source' succeeded for =dev-java/piccolo2d-3.0-r2
USE='doc examples source' succeeded for =dev-java/piccolo2d-3.0-r2

revdep tests started on Mo 19. Jul 00:48:59 CEST 2021

FEATURES=' test' USE='scrollview' succeeded for app-text/tesseract
Comment 4 Sergei Trofimovich (RETIRED) gentoo-dev 2021-07-25 00:35:07 UTC
ppc64 stable thanks to ernsteiswuerfel!

All arches done.
Comment 5 NATTkA bot gentoo-dev 2021-07-25 06:32:30 UTC Comment hidden (obsolete)
Comment 6 NATTkA bot gentoo-dev 2021-07-26 01:16:43 UTC Comment hidden (obsolete)
Comment 7 NATTkA bot gentoo-dev 2021-07-30 15:52:43 UTC Comment hidden (obsolete)
Comment 8 NATTkA bot gentoo-dev 2021-10-22 16:12:49 UTC Comment hidden (obsolete)
Comment 9 NATTkA bot gentoo-dev 2021-10-23 16:04:59 UTC Comment hidden (obsolete)
Comment 10 NATTkA bot gentoo-dev 2021-11-10 18:16:57 UTC Comment hidden (obsolete)
Comment 11 NATTkA bot gentoo-dev 2021-11-18 19:37:48 UTC
Sanity check failed:

> dev-java/piccolo2d-3.0-r2
>   depend x86 stable profile default/linux/x86/17.0 (20 total)
>     dev-java/swt:4.10
>   rdepend x86 stable profile default/linux/x86/17.0 (20 total)
>     dev-java/swt:4.10
Comment 12 Volkmar W. Pogatzki 2021-11-18 20:49:17 UTC
This package has no consumers and should be last-rited instead of stabilized.
Comment 13 Larry the Git Cow gentoo-dev 2021-11-19 09:11:22 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=0ab8f911fead1fddfad578417406949db9503feb

commit 0ab8f911fead1fddfad578417406949db9503feb
Author:     Volkmar W. Pogatzki <gentoo@pogatzki.net>
AuthorDate: 2021-11-18 20:42:09 +0000
Commit:     Jakov Smolić <jsmolic@gentoo.org>
CommitDate: 2021-11-19 09:10:51 +0000

    profiles/package.mask: last-rite dev-java/piccolo2d
    
    Closes: https://bugs.gentoo.org/788127
    
    Signed-off-by: Volkmar W. Pogatzki <gentoo@pogatzki.net>
    Closes: https://github.com/gentoo/gentoo/pull/22989
    Signed-off-by: Jakov Smolić <jsmolic@gentoo.org>

 profiles/package.mask | 4 ++++
 1 file changed, 4 insertions(+)